Waterfront dining is typically the purvey of coastal cities. Beach towns, New England, California: these are likely the spots that come to mind when you think of dining with a waterside view. As a landlocked state, we admit that there aren’t as many options for waterfront restaurants in Kansas. But that doesn’t mean there’s none, and one of our favorites is The Old Spaghetti Factory in Wichita. This place offers up waterfront dining like you’d find in a coastal city, the food is excellent, and the ambiance is lovely. Check it out:
The Old Spaghetti Factory has several locations throughout the United States, but this is the only one in Kansas. It has been in this location for just a few years but has proved to be quite popular.
Like all The Old Spaghetti Factory locations, the Wichita restaurant has a trolley car in the dining room where diners can sit and eat. You'll also find the chain's signature antique lighting and beautiful decor.
Dining here is a great opportunity for a family-friendly waterfront restaurant in Kansas that won't break the bank. All dishes come with bread and a soup or salad.
